SJ opens CA's largest outdoor skatepark

SAN JOSE, CA

The 68,000-square-foot Lake Cunningham Regional Skatepark will be open on weekdays at 11 a.m. and weekends at 9 a.m. It costs $2 per visit, or $50 annually. It's equipped with a full, 22-foot-tall pipe, 10 bowls ranging from beginner-to-expert levels and a street course.

The $4.7 million park will close about 30 minutes before sunset daily.

The ceremony, which will include giveaways, long jump contests and public skating is scheduled from 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. at 2305 South White Road.
